17. Provide any additional details about the incident

(eg. description of the frequency and severity of the symptoms

On Jan 7, 2008 the owner bathed the cat, more than nine hours after exposure. APSS advised she take the cat to an emergency clinic and have the attending veterinarian contact APSS for further recommendations. The cat was hospitalized on Jan 7, 2008 where it received fluid therapy, symptomatic and supportive care, as well as seizure management. The cat died on January 9, 2008.

19. Provide supplemental information here

A dog product, containing permethrin, was used on the cat. This is inappropriate use of the product
